The ION Audio Raptor is an ultra-portable, 100-watt wireless speaker designed for all terrains. With a robust water-resistant body, it features a long-lasting 75-hour rechargeable battery, Bluetooth streaming capabilities, and an AM/FM radio, making it the perfect companion for outdoor adventures and gatherings.

Loud and Clear/ Battery Lasts Forever!
UPDATE: People complain about the speaker not having adjustable treble/bass features. However, if you are streaming music from a smart phone via Bluetooth, most phones have these features. For instance, the louder I play the speaker, I reduce the bass from my iPhone settings, per the picture. Problem solved in the type of scenario.I bought the Ion Raptor about 1.5 months ago, and I use it primarily while playing outdoor sand volleyball. I’ve used it about 7 times for about 4 hours during each use, and the battery barely lost 1 bar (4 bars total capacity). The battery really does last such a long time! Furthermore, for each use, the volume on the Raptor was set at about 75%, which was perfect for an outdoor setting.***I would advise that if the operator is using this speaker by pairing with a mobile phone, do not set the volume all the way to Max on your phone. Otherwise you’ll hear a little distortion in sound as you bring up the volume on the speaker itself. I limit my phone volume to about 80%, and adjust the rest of the volume in the Ion Raptor. ***
